2013-10-19 102 views
0

DNS遞歸解析究竟如何工作:在進行遞歸時,在每個級別,您是否要求服務器輸出您嘗試解析的記錄(例如l.p.example.net.),以及您嘗試解析的類型(例如AAAAA),或者您是否確實詢問誰要爲您嘗試查找記錄的域負責?遞歸DNS:你是否要求在每個級別或'NS'的`A`?

例如,如果某些服務器是權威域example.net.,而且是遞歸的,如果p.example.net.實際上是NS委託給其他第三方服務器,將這樣的第三方服務器實際上獲得任何流量,或將在遞歸上層服務器不能通過已經在其原始權限下提供所有的解決方案來實現這種可能性?

回答

0

遞歸解析器應該每次詢問它正在嘗試解析的記錄。如果有什麼需要解決的是一個,然後一個查詢發送到根服務器,.COM服務器等

如果p.example.com委託給一個獨立的服務器,然後在example.com區域,應該存在p.example.com的NS記錄。如果此類委託NS記錄存在,example.com服務器知道p.example.com委託給另一臺服務器,並且在查詢p.example.com「A」記錄時,將以NS回答p.example.com的記錄。

這並不重要wheather example.com服務器也是遞歸或不遞歸。